Scott Arthur Fitzgerald
December 11, 1976 ~ January 2, 2021 (age 44)

Scott Fitzgerald passed away on January 2, 2021 at age 44 in St. John's Hospital in Maplewood, MN.

Scott graduated from Marcus High School in 1995; earned his Bachelor's degree from Texas A&M University and his MBA from Southern Methodist University. He had a life long career at 3M in St. Paul, MN with his last position as a Global Business Manager in the Transportation Markets Division.

Scott is survived by his children, Aynsley and Landon; parents, Brian Fitzgerald and Rebecca Fitzgerald-Martin as well as siblings Drew (Ashleigh) of Lake Charles, LA and Kelly of Flower Mound. He is also survived by loving aunts, uncles, nieces, and cousins as well as many dear friends.

Scott's favorite moments in life were spent skiing with his son, cooking with his daughter and spending time with his family and friends. Scott had a great love for soccer, the Texas Aggies and the Dallas Cowboys. He found joy in grilling, music, and making people laugh. Scott will always be remembered as a devoted son and brother, a loving father and a loyal friend.

A celebration of his life will take place at a later date in Flower Mound, TX.
